Although the majority of chemicals in beauty products and cosmetics pose hardly any or no threat, some have been linked to significant medical issues, such as neurological harm and cancer. Chemicals in cosmetics can enter your body through inhalation, the skin, and ingestion, and cause similar risks as food chemicals, per this site.
Chemicals and contaminants associated with cancer can be found in water, food, and many other commonly used items. But, no category of consumer items is susceptible to less government inspection than cosmetics and other personal products, including Lip Gloss (South Beach). Though many of the chemicals in cosmetics in all likelihood pose minimal risk, exposure to a few has been associated with significant health concerns, including cancer.
